Transaction cdcc673083371dd31c6486f6baeca5b6ec6f7dd60a280914815fd35e74132569

210 Input
2 Outputs
  • cdcc673083371dd31c6486f6baeca5b6ec6f7dd60a280914815fd35e74132569:0
  • value  1046
    address  3QxNS6XtsYzcL5Re4t649Ho5CBVV5Xck7k
  • cdcc673083371dd31c6486f6baeca5b6ec6f7dd60a280914815fd35e74132569:1
  • value  600000000
    address  186kADRdd9MkeFqo846jGVVrZs8AEBV6ce